# Quellmark alert deduplicator — on-call env config.
# This service collapses duplicate pages from the Fenwick monitoring mesh
# before they reach the rotation. Dedup windows are tuned per severity;
# changing DEDUP_WINDOW_SECS without consulting the runbook will cause
# either alert storms or silent drops. Restart the worker after any edit,
# and verify the heartbeat page still fires. The signing secret for the
# pager bridge is set on the next line.

sealed setting: ARCHIVE_KEY3=8d0

## Data Stores — Monthly Partitioning

Quick note for review: the Ledgerline events table is partitioned by month, with a nightly job creating next month's partition ahead of time. Partitions older than 13 months get dropped automatically, so retention is enforced at the schema level. If you want to poke at the partition layout yourself, connect with the string below.

database URL for tajog-bajeg: mysql://soreth_svc:OzsCjhu@db-6997.nelvrostack.internal:5432/kelax

Producers must register schemas before publishing; the registry enforces backward compatibility by default. New team members: never delete a schema version, deprecate instead. If producers report rejected publishes, check compatibility mode first, then the registry's health endpoint. Outages block all event publishing, so page the stream team immediately if the registry is down. For local debugging, run a registry replica against the snapshot store using the following configuration values.

service settings:
[casax]
port = 6379
team = rusir
host = casax.zemvarhq.corp
region = outer-4
access_code = ac_9808ce
timeout_ms = 1500

**Changelog — TideGlass widget (v2.8)**

Defaults changed this sprint. The TideGlass tide-table widget now refreshes every 15 minutes instead of hourly, and the default station set is Harbor Pell rather than Cape Ondler. Interpolation between readings is now on by default, which smooths the chart but adds a small CPU cost on older kiosks. Teams overriding these values in Marrowbay deployments are unaffected. Nothing else in the rendering path changed. The full set of defaults as shipped in this release is listed below.

service settings:
PRAWYN_PIN=9848
PRAWYN_METRICS_HOST=metrics.prawyn.lumicworks.corp
PRAWYN_LOG_LEVEL=warn
PRAWYN_TENANT=pelius